CRAQ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2026 in Review
57 of the 8,317 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Cal Redwood Acquisition Corp (CRAQ) for Q2 2026, worth a combined $232M — up 1.5% from $229M a quarter earlier.
Buyers outnumbered sellers: 2 funds opened new CRAQ positions and 1 closed out — a net gain of 1 holder — while 8 added to existing stakes and 8 trimmed.
The largest buyer was Highbridge Capital Management, adding an estimated $2.18M. The largest seller was Toronto Dominion Bank, cutting an estimated $2.49M.
